10 Twisted Anime That Will Keep You Up at Night

10 Twisted Anime That Will Keep You Up at Night

Viewer discretion is advised.

Anime may get pretty unhinged sometimes, which is one of the reasons we love this type of media so much. We’re not always in the mood for something chill and relaxing. And if this time’s come for you, here’s a list of great series you might want to try out.

 - image 1

  1. Elfen Lied (2004)

Although this anime is celebrating its 20th anniversary this year, it doesn’t mean it should be forgotten. This is a true anime horror classic that you just have to watch if you’re into the genre.

Lucy is a Diclonius, a special breed of humans with supernatural abilities. Her invisible telekinetic hands can become deadly to a poor soul who wishes her harm.

Lucy was tortured and experimented on, so once she gets a chance to escape, she takes it, leaving a trail of blood and corpses behind her.

MyAnimeList score: 7.47

 - image 2

  1. Made in Abyss (2017)

This anime is notorious for being one of the most disturbing series out there. Although it might not feel this way when you first start watching it, give it a chance, and Made in Abyss will surprise you with all sorts of horrors.

Abyss is a giant hole stretching deep into the Earth. Only the bravest Divers are ready to explore this place.

Riko lives just beside the Abyss and dreams of exploring the depths of it, just like her mother. When an unsettling message arrives, Riko has no choice but to travel to the Abyss, accompanied by a boy robot, Reg.

MyAnimeList score: 8.65

 - image 3

  1. Deadman Wonderland (2011)

Fans are still upset that this anime never got Season 2, they wanted the madness to keep going.

Ganta and his class are getting ready for a class field trip to Deadman Wonderland, a prison amusement park. The trip goes terribly wrong as all of his classmates are massacred by a mysterious man in red. Framed for the incident and sentenced to death, Ganta is sent to the very jail he was supposed to visit.

MyAnimeList score: 7.14

 - image 4

  1. Tokyo Ghoul (2014)

We’re sure you’ve heard that Tokyo Ghoul is a terrible anime adaptation and the manga is better. While these accusations are mostly true, Season 1 of the series is still worth watching.

Kaneki used to be a regular college student, who just wanted to take a girl out for dinner. But the evening went unexpectedly wrong, and Kaneki became dinner himself, when his date, Rize, revealed herself to be a ghoul.

Kaneki managed to get away, while Rize met her death. The boy was taken to a hospital, where doctors transplanted Rize’s organs into his body, turning him into a half-ghoul.

MyAnimeList score: 7.79

 - image 5

  1. Another (2012)

If you’re into supernatural horrors with lots of mysteries and secrets, this one might be just for you.

Kouichi wasn’t in class for a month because of his illness. When he finally recovers and comes back to school, a new classmate catches his interest. Mei is quiet and very mysterious, but what’s even more puzzling is that other classmates don’t seem to acknowledge her existence. Meanwhile, strange and frightening things start to happen.

MyAnimeList score: 7.47

 - image 6

  1. Higurashi: When They Cry (2006)

Keiichi’s just moved to a new village, where he was quick to make new friends. But his seemingly peaceful life is clouded by a dark turn of events. The village holds an annual festival, which is accompanied by a series of mystical and grim incidents.

When Keiichi asks his new friends about them, they seem suspiciously quiet. He starts questioning everything, but is eager to learn the truth about this mystery and uncover some dark secrets, which lead him to the origin of the festival and the local god it is dedicated to.

MyAnimeList score: 7.88

 - image 7

  1. The Future Diary (2011)

This anime used to be a big deal back in the day. Although now a lot of fans consider it overly-edgy, they still can’t forget one of the craziest and most entertaining female leads, Yuno.

Yukiteru is a normal shy school student with a hobby of writing down everything that happens to him in his phone diary. But one day he discovers that his diary can actually predict the future, and he’s dragged into a battle royale with other diary users.

Who would’ve thought that the eccentric and absolutely insane Yuno is his best ally now, since her diary can predict Yukiteru’s future.

MyAnimeList score: 7.40

 - image 8

  1. Shiki (2010)

Outstanding suspense, vampires, deaths and gore ― you’ll find all of that in Shiki, and you’re going to love the anime for how dark it truly is.

A small town, where everyone knows each other, a mysterious death, and tons of secrets. Shiki has everything a respectful horror should have.

Megumi is a young girl who dies unexpectedly from an unnamed illness. But she’s not the only one, others follow suit, and the town’s doctor starts suspecting that something more than a simple illness is going on here.

MyAnimeList score: 7.73

 - image 9

  1. Dark Gathering (2023)

If you’re looking for something rather new, then you should try out Dark Gathering.

Due to an encounter with a spirit, Keitarou’s right hand is cursed now. But this is not the beginning of Parasyte, this series is different.

Keitarou doesn’t want the curse to dictate his life, so he tries to be as normal as possible. His friend encourages him to become a private tutor, and his first client turns out to be Yayoi, a girl with two pupils in each eye, who can see into the spirit world.

MyAnimeList score: 7.85

 - image 10

  1. Chainsaw Man (2022)

If you still haven’t seen one of the best modern shounens out there, then what are you waiting for? Chainsaw Man will definitely shock you with a lot of explicit content, but you’ll enjoy every bit of it.

Denji’s struggling with life. He has no friends, no family, and his only companion is a pet devil Pochita, who helps him deal with small devils and make a living.

When Denji is betrayed by the mafia he’s been working for, he’s on the verge of death. But Pochita merges with the man, turning him into a devil hybrid.

MyAnimeList score: 8.51
